feat(core): store turn_id on ResponseItem metadata (#28360)

## Description

This PR is a followup to https://github.com/openai/codex/pull/28355 and
starts assigning `internal_chat_message_metadata_passthrough.turn_id` to
durable Responses API items created during a turn.

The goal is that those items keep the `turn_id` that introduced them
when Codex resends stateless HTTP context, reconstructs history for
resume/fork paths, or reuses websocket response state.

## What changed

- Set `internal_chat_message_metadata_passthrough.turn_id` when missing
as response items enter durable history, initial/replacement history,
inter-agent communication history, and local compaction summaries.
- Preserve existing item turn IDs instead of overwriting them during
persistence, resume reconstruction, compaction, forked history, and
websocket incremental reuse.
- Keep `compaction_trigger` fieldless because it is a request control,
not a durable response item.
- Update focused history/request assertions and fixtures for stateless
requests, websocket incrementals, compaction, thread injection, prompt
debug, and related CI coverage.
